Our story
Built by people who camp
The RV business ran the same way for forty years: a lot, a salesperson, a sticker price nobody expected you to pay, and a finance office where the real numbers appeared. It worked for dealers. It did not work for the family trying to get on the road by spring.
We built Caravan AVM around a simpler idea — put every unit online with real photographs, the complete spec sheet and one price that does not move. No finance office, no back-end products, and delivery that brings the RV to your driveway instead of making you drive across three states to collect it.
Today we carry 5,221 new and used RVs from 79 manufacturers, and deliver to all fifty states. The team behind it camps most weekends, which is the main reason we are unreasonable about inspection standards.

What we hold to
Four things we do not compromise on
One honest price
The number on the listing is the number you pay. No dealer prep, no documentation fee, no four-hour negotiation to arrive at what the RV was always worth.
Show everything
Real photographs of the actual unit, the full manufacturer spec sheet, and the inspection findings — including what we did not fix.
Stand behind it
Multi-point inspection before shipping, a 7-day window to raise anything undisclosed, and a service network to call afterwards.
Sell the right RV
A specialist who talks you out of a unit that will not fit your truck is doing their job. We would rather lose a sale than sell you the wrong thing.

How we are set up
An online dealer, not a lot
We hold inventory at partner facilities across the country rather than on one expensive piece of retail real estate. That is why our prices are what they are — you are not paying for a showroom you will visit once.
Every unit is inspected at its holding facility before it ships, by technicians who do nothing else. Our specialists work by phone and email, so you get someone who knows the inventory rather than whoever happened to be free on the lot.
Head office is in Elkhart, IN — the middle of the American RV manufacturing industry, which is exactly where you want to be when you need a warranty part in a hurry.
